hay Learn Unstarted Summary The Spanish translation for “there is” is hay. Examples of "there is" in use There are 17 examples of the Spanish word for "there is" being used: Recording English Spanish Learn There’s no proof. No hay pruebas. Learn No refunds. No hay reembolsos. Learn There is always something happening here. Siempre hay algo que sucede aquí. Learn There are many caves in the mountain. Hay muchas cuevas en la montaña. Learn He lives in a house where there are many trees. Vive en una casa donde hay muchos árboles. Learn There are similarities between Korean and Japanese. Hay similitudes entre coreano y japonés. Learn There is a good market for these articles. Hay un buen mercado para estos artículos.
